Gareth Malone Goes to Glyndebourne

Gareth Malone Goes to Glyndebourne (2010)

EndedDocumentary showMusic

Gareth Malone, star of BBC Two's The Choir, takes on one of his biggest challenges to date, joining the production team at Glyndebourne in the role of youth chorus leader on his first opera.
